"A great place to eat and drink. Nice open plan layout with function room upstairs. A good choice of ales and drinks, food choices were wide ranging. My partner is a vegetarian and had a range of choices, I plumped for the fish and chips, one of the most flavoursome I have ever had. Staff were great and friendly, helping us to move tables. Would have given 5 stars, but, why o why have the telly on, then loud music blaring, consequently everyone has to raise their voices. Manager, please note who if any, are singing along to the music, who if any, are watching telly. Almost 100 per cent are talking to others ! Other than that personal opinion, its a friendly well managed and pleasant public house. Cheers"
